Having spent a full day at Disney World, I’ve learned that planning is key to making the most of your visit. Arriving early allows you to beat the crowds and enjoy popular rides with minimal wait times. Prioritize iconic attractions like Space Mountain, Pirates of the Caribbean, and the Haunted Mansion to capture the classic Disney magic. Comfortable footwear is a must because you’ll do a lot of walking across the expansive park. Bringing a portable phone charger also helps to keep your devices powered for photos, mobile tickets, and the Disney app, which is invaluable for checking ride wait times and booking Lightning Lane entries. For dining, consider quick-service options or pre-book dining reservations to save time. Don’t forget to hydrate and take short breaks in shaded areas to stay refreshed throughout the day.
